Shobanjo honoured for function in promoting

Veteran promoting and advertising chief and the chairman of Troyka Holdings, Biodun Shobanjo, has turn out to be the primary recipient of the BB Apprenticeship Award by the Bolaji Junaid Mentorship Programme, recognising his important contributions to mentorship and business progress in Nigeria.
On the third version of BJuMP’s Mentors Meet Mentees Mixer held not too long ago in Lagos, the founding father of BJuMP, Bolaji Junaid, described the award as a tribute to leaders who’ve profoundly formed the careers of younger professionals in company Africa.
Jimi Awosika was honoured alongside Shobanjo, with each receiving accolades for his or her enduring affect on the promoting and advertising panorama.
Junaid lauded Shobanjo’s legacy, emphasising that past constructing an business, he has constructed generations of execs.
The occasion featured a hearth chat with Shobanjo, the place he mirrored on the sector’s transformation.
“Over 43 years in the past, promoting was not a most popular sector. Right this moment, it generates over N605bn yearly,” he famous.
Shobanjo confused that the business’s future lies within the fingers of younger professionals, highlighting the essential function mentorship performs in profession growth.
He additionally shared insights on mentor-mentee relationships, noting, “The circumstances that decide a mentee leaving his mentor will decide whether or not a relationship will persist.”
Including to the tributes, the Director-Common of the Promoting Regulatory Council of Nigeria, Olalekan Fadolapo, represented by Winifred Akpa, recommended Shobanjo’s contributions, stating that his affect might be remembered for generations.
The occasion additionally noticed the disclosing of Tripreneur, a e book by Bolaji Junaid, chronicling his journey via entrepreneurship, sociopreneurship, and intrapreneurship, providing classes to younger professionals looking for profession resilience.
With Shobanjo and Awosika as the primary honourees, the BB Apprenticeship Award units a brand new benchmark for recognising mentorship excellence in company Africa.
